WEBMay 4, 2021 · Although more commonly referred to as “refrigerator” or “freezer” cookies, they were originally named “icebox” cookies since the dough was shaped into a log and frozen in an icebox, or an old-fashioned freezer. Freezing the dough makes it easier to …
